Package: apache2-common
Severity: normal


It is not possible to purge apache2-common (after upgrading to
apache2.2-common), because the post-rm scripts removes some files that
are requeried by apache2.2 (e.g. /etc/apache2/httpd.conf).

It is not possible to purge apache2-common (after upgrading to
apache2.2-common), because the post-rm scripts removes some files that
are requeried by apache2.2 (e.g. /etc/apache2/httpd.conf).

This has been worked around in apache2.2-common version 2.2.3-2.
